Q: Is 151,401,635 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 151,401,635 is a composite number.

Why is 151,401,635 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 151,401,635 can be evenly divided by 1 5 7 11 35 55 73 77 365 385 511 803 2,555 4,015 5,387 5,621 26,935 28,105 37,709 59,257 188,545 296,285 393,251 414,799 1,966,255 2,073,995 2,752,757 4,325,761 13,763,785 21,628,805 30,280,327 and 151,401,635, with no remainder.

Since 151,401,635 cannot be divided by just 1 and 151,401,635, it is a composite number.
